What's new in this version:

Added slicing capabilities for resin printers (called DLPSlicer):
- support for photon format (cbddlp), png output, wow and b9j format
- able to process CSG scripts and stl models
- includes support structure generation
- ability to lift the print, add drainage holes and generate a raft
- cutting plane is now a global UI element (in Bed positioning and Inspection section on the settings panel)
- added plugin system documentation link to Help section
- fixed discontinuity bug for dense cunston shader infills
- refactored internal settings with *per_pixels names to *per_pixel for semantic consistency

Forge:
- added netrual transformation functions when drag and dropping stl models
- force script udpate when drag and dropping assets even when auto refresh is disabled
Plugins:
- Post-Processing plugins: added boolean parameter to allow the user to know/set when a layer is spiralized
- Post-Processing plugins: added boolean flag to indicate when a layer is divided into different parts based on the extruder it’s using
- Machine-code plugins: IceSL now informs when plugin reports and error
- Machine-code plugins: fixed bug where IceSL would not correctly deduce the output format when raising a save file dialog

Slicecrafter:
- added slicing capabilities for resin printers
